Company Introduction – Kiewit

Kiewit Corporation is one of North America’s largest construction and engineering organizations. The company delivers major projects in industries including industrial construction, transportation, energy, water, and infrastructure.

Kiewit has built a reputation for managing complex projects while focusing on safety, quality, and innovation. The company employs thousands of professionals, including engineers, project managers, construction specialists, and safety experts.  

Safety is a major part of Kiewit’s workplace culture. The company’s safety teams help implement project safety plans, monitor compliance, support training programs, and improve workplace safety performance.  


Job Responsibilities – Safety Specialist

A Safety Specialist at Kiewit supports project teams by helping maintain a safe working environment.

Main responsibilities include:

Safety Program Support

  • Assist with implementing project safety plans
  • Support safety procedures and company standards
  • Monitor workplace safety activities
  • Help improve safety performance

Site Safety Inspections

  • Perform regular jobsite inspections
  • Identify hazards and unsafe conditions
  • Recommend corrective actions
  • Follow up on safety improvements

OSHA Compliance

The Safety Specialist helps ensure construction activities follow:

  • OSHA regulations
  • Company safety policies
  • Client safety requirements
  • Industry best practices

Employee Safety Training

Responsibilities may include:

  • New employee safety orientation
  • Toolbox meetings
  • Safety awareness sessions
  • Emergency response training

Incident Reporting

Safety professionals may assist with:

  • Accident investigations
  • Safety documentation
  • Corrective action planning
  • Incident prevention strategies

Safety Specialist Interview Tips – Kiewit USA

Preparing for a safety interview requires knowledge of construction safety practices and strong communication skills.

Common Interview Questions

1. Tell us about your safety experience.

Answer Tip:

Explain your experience with:

  • Workplace inspections
  • Hazard identification
  • Safety training
  • Incident prevention

Mention specific projects or environments where you supported safety improvement.


2. What is the importance of OSHA regulations?

Answer Tip:

Explain that OSHA standards help protect workers by establishing workplace safety requirements, reducing hazards, and preventing injuries.


3. How do you handle an unsafe work situation?

Answer Tip:

A good answer should include:

  • Identifying the hazard
  • Communicating with the team
  • Stopping unsafe activities when necessary
  • Finding a safe solution
  • Documenting corrective action


4. Describe your experience with safety inspections.

Mention:

  • Daily site inspections
  • Hazard reports
  • Corrective actions
  • Safety documentation


5. How do you encourage workers to follow safety procedures?

Explain that effective safety requires:

  • Respectful communication
  • Regular training
  • Building trust with workers
  • Leading by example
